Extreme Leftists from the New York Times are threatening Carlson and his family, as they are supposedly planning on publishing his new home address in order to shut him up.

Last week the New York Times began working on a story about where my family and I live. As a matter of journalism, there is no conceivable justification for a story like that,” he revealed. “The paper is not alleging we’ve done anything wrong, and we haven’t. We pay our taxes. We like our neighbors. We’ve never had a dispute with anyone. So why is the New York Times doing a story on the location of my family’s house?”

“Well, you know why,” he said. “To hurt us, to injure my wife and kids so that I will shut up and stop disagreeing with them.”

Carlson said that the outlet reportedly planned to run the information in a report this week.

“Editors there know exactly what will happen to my family when it does run,” he insisted. “I called them today and I told them. But they didn’t care. They hate my politics. They want this show off the air. If one of my children gets hurt because of a story they wrote, they won’t consider it collateral damage. They know it’s the whole point of the exercise: to inflict pain on our family, to terrorize us, to control what we say.”

The New York Times tweeted in response saying that it wasn’t true.

.@nytimes does not plan to publish Tucker Carlson’s residence, which Carlson was aware of before his broadcast tonight.
